What is EAT?

EAT, or Equine Assisted Therapy combines traditional mental health therapy with the intuitive nature of horses. Therapy sessions include a licensed mental health professional, a certified equine specialist, a client, and a herd of horses. Clients work with the horses to find metaphors for real-life situations and achieve personal goals.

What populations do you serve?

We serve all ages five and up! We work with individuals with goals of communication, anxiety and depression, relationship building, PTSD and trauma, victims of domestic abuse, veterans, couples, and families.

How much does a horse weigh?

Horses weigh an average of 1000-1200 pounds.

What do horses eat?

Horses eat forage – hay and sometimes grain. They are herbivores and prey animals.
